January 18-22, Hy-Tech attends AME Remote Roundup
Hy-Tech Drilling participated virtually at the AME Roundup during 18-22 January 2021 with more than 70 other companies and organizations. We hope you were able to visit our booth which will remain available until July 2021.
Hy-Tech Employees Receive Prestigious Newcrest’s 2020 Living Our Values (LOV) Award
Congratulations to Craig Spinney, Brian Bakker and all of the Hy-Tech team who supported and worked at Newcrest’s Red Chris site last year. This year the Red Chris exploration team of Nick Fitzpatrick, Ted Muraro, Karl McNamara, and Dillon Hume, along with Hy-Tech’s Craig Spinney and Brian Bakker won the High-Performance LOV award. Hy-Tech Receives CDDA Safety Awards
Hy-Tech Drilling is a proud recipient of multiple CDDA Safety Awards in recognition of our continuous efforts to raise the standard of worker health and safety in the drilling industry.
